" A detached bungalow in a highly regarded Teign Valley village. 2 double bedrooms, kitchen, sitting room, dining hall, modern bathroom. Garage. Parking. Level gardens. Views.

SITUATION 6 Wood Close is situated in the popular Teign Valley village of Christow, just within the eastern boundary of the Dartmoor National Park. The village has a strong community with a doctors surgery, shop/post office, village store, well regarded pub, primary school, parish church and community centre.   There are regular bus services into Exeter and Newton Abbot. The university and cathedral city of Exeter lies approximately 8 miles to the east, and has a wide range of facilities and amenities one would expect of a centre of its size including excellent dining, shopping, theatre and sporting and recreational pursuits. There are mainline railway stations on the London Paddington and Waterloo lines. Exeter International Airport lies about 4 miles to the east of the city.   Due to its position within the Dartmoor National Park, there is ample opportunity for a range of outdoor pursuits within the vicinity including excellent walking, riding and cycling.   The A38 is approximately 5 miles distant, providing excellent access to both Plymouth and M5 to the north. DESCRIPTION 6 Wood Close is a detached bungalow situated in a quiet cul-de-sac in the Teign Valley village of Christow. Built in approximately 1970 with a later extension, of brick elevations beneath a tiled roof, the property offers spacious accommodation and benefits from double glazing, oil-fired central heating and cavity wall insulation.   Front door leads to the reception hallway off which are the principal living rooms. There is a good size, dual aspect sitting room, with feature fireplace with inset gas fire. Double doors lead out to the gardens. The modern fitted kitchen has a range of matching eye and base level units, including an integrated fridge, sink with drainer and electric cooker. There are two good sized double bedrooms, one with fitted wardrobes. The family bathroom is a modern 3-piece white suite comprising panelled bath with shower over, low level wc and pedestal wash basin. The L-shaped hallway has a large area for dining table and chairs, as well as door to the garage. OUTSIDE A driveway with parking for one vehicle, leads to the large garage/utility room, with up-and-over door, power and light connected, space and plumbing for washing machine, tumble dryer and freezer, work surfaces and cupboards. A path leads around to the front door through the front garden which is enclosed and laid to level lawn and interspersed with a number of flower and shrub beds. To the left hand side of the property a lawn leads around to the rear garden, which is again enclosed and level. This is also accessed via a pedestrian gateway. At the far end is a large paved patio area and shed. There is much interest for the keen gardener with many mature trees, shrubs and flower beds. There are also some excellent views across the valley to the surrounding countryside. AGENTS NOTE Due to the size of the loft, and the pitch of the roof, there is ample opportunity to create further accommodation on the first floor, subject to obtaining the necessary planning consents.
